PHILADELPHIA, PA — A church and residents near an adult video store in the Bridesburg section of Philadelphia are fighting against an electronic upgrade to the store’s 110-foot billboard.
Risque Video, which specializes in pornographic films and sex toys, was granted a variance to install a LED digital billboard on the 4800 block of James Street in April. Permission to build the double-sided board that would flash and change at four to six-second intervals was given despite the fact that zoning code laws prohibit billboards with flashing lights within 1,000 feet of residences, according to PlanPhilly.com.
